Roger Federer and On Running Drop THE ROGER Clubhouse Mid

On Running introduces its new sneaker with the launch of THE ROGER Clubhouse Mid sneaker that is made to honor the iconic caddie days of Roger Federer. The Swiss sports imprint delivers a mid-cut iteration of the shoe as a nod to the early 90s and the shoes that were worn by tennis champions. It has a sleek silhouette that features a variety of vegan leather layers.

The upper part includes protruding flats that have hidden pockets right at the ankle collar section. More hidden details can be seen in the form of the brand's cushioned CloudTec sole technology that is fused together with a Spedboard layer at the midsole to ensure comfort all day.
